Sony Vpl-Xw7000Es 2026: Is It Suitable For Gaming Monitors?

The Sony VPL-XW7000ES, released in 2026, is primarily marketed as a high-end home theater projector. Its advanced features and impressive specifications have sparked discussions about its suitability for gaming purposes. This article explores whether the VPL-XW7000ES can be considered a good option for gamers seeking a large, immersive display experience.

Key Features of the Sony VPL-XW7000ES

  • Native 4K resolution for sharp images
  • High brightness of 2,000 lumens, suitable for various lighting conditions
  • Advanced laser light source with long lifespan
  • Low input lag designed for fast response times
  • HDR support for enhanced contrast and color accuracy
  • Flexible installation options with zoom and lens shift

Advantages for Gaming

The VPL-XW7000ES offers several features that appeal to gamers. Its high resolution and HDR support provide vivid, detailed visuals that can enhance gameplay immersion. The high brightness ensures visibility even in well-lit rooms, reducing the need to darken the environment.

Additionally, the projector’s low input lag is critical for gaming, as it minimizes delays between controller input and on-screen action. The flexible installation options allow gamers to set up the projector in various room configurations, creating a large, cinematic display area.

Potential Limitations for Gaming

Despite its strengths, the Sony VPL-XW7000ES may have some limitations when used as a gaming monitor. The native resolution, while excellent for movies and general use, may not match the pixel density of high-end gaming monitors designed specifically for competitive gaming.

Furthermore, projectors generally have higher latency compared to dedicated gaming monitors. Although the VPL-XW7000ES features low input lag, it might still not meet the ultra-low latency standards preferred by professional gamers.

Comparison with Traditional Gaming Monitors

  • Resolution: Gaming monitors often feature higher refresh rates and faster response times, whereas projectors focus on image quality and size.
  • Latency: Dedicated gaming monitors typically have lower input lag, essential for competitive gaming.
  • Size and Immersion: Projectors like the VPL-XW7000ES excel in creating large, immersive screens that are hard to replicate with standard monitors.
  • Portability: Monitors are more portable and easier to set up for quick gaming sessions.

Conclusion: Is It Suitable for Gaming?

The Sony VPL-XW7000ES offers impressive features that can enhance gaming experiences, especially for casual gamers who value large screens and stunning visuals. However, for competitive gaming where ultra-low latency and high refresh rates are critical, dedicated gaming monitors may still be the better choice.

Ultimately, the VPL-XW7000ES is suitable for gamers who prioritize a cinematic, immersive environment over the ultra-responsive performance required in fast-paced, competitive gaming.
